Painting By Faith

paintingArt or painting is undoubtedly a symbolic representation of people’s thoughts, beliefs, and values. The term “medium,” often used to describe various types of materials used in creating a piece of art, or painting suggests that it exists as a midway point between the artist’s mind and the audience.

Not only does the painting itself help us understand the artist or sculptor who created it, but the very medium through which artists choose to work can reveal something about them. Art, then, is a method of communication, full of symbolism, between an artist and the public.

In no other category of painting is this symbolism more prominent than in religious art. For many, religion is a deeply held belief system that evokes powerful emotional and spiritual responses.

To elicit these emotions in the public, an artist must be skilled and adept in working with their chosen medium. An understanding of religious iconography, or those images specifically related to a faith, is also crucial for an artist who wants to create a piece of religious art.

A true master of religious art can create a piece that represents values held by many. It is no small wonder, then, that art has …

There are two types of bass guitar pedals: multi-effects pedals and dedicated effects pedals. Each model has distinct advantages, depending on your playing style. Let’s examine both types to help you decide which one suits your needs best.

Multi-effects pedals are single units that offer multiple effects. Some musicians find this design to be a disadvantage because the large number of effects crammed into one device can make it difficult to obtain the perfect sound. Additionally, the quality of the effects may be compromised. However, multi-effects pedals are a great introduction to various effects and can teach you how to adjust them effectively.

Dedicated effects pedals, on the other hand, produce a single effect. If you frequently use a specific effect, this type of pedal may be the better choice. With only one effect generated, the quality is generally higher. You can also use multiple dedicated effects pedals to achieve a range of effects or try a modular setup.

Art Deco Enhancing

art decoEverything old is new again. This saying holds true for Art Deco decorating, which originated in the 1920s and 1930s and is currently experiencing a resurgence in various forms of interior decor. Art Deco draws much of its styling from the popular art movements of the time, Cubism and Futurism. Cubism, led by renowned artists like Pablo Picasso and Georges Braque, involved breaking up objects in a painting and reassembling them in an abstract way. Futurism, which started in Italy, emphasized industry and technology and their impact on the world. Now that we have some background on Art Deco, how can you apply its design principles when decorating your home?

Common motifs in Art Deco pieces include zigzags and geometric shapes with bold patterns. Typical materials used in this style of decor are aluminum, lacquered wood with inlay, and stainless steel. Bold colors are essential for achieving this look in a room. Using neutrals for walls provides a clean palette to add splashes of color. Thin stenciling on walls in corners or near the ceiling can make a nice accent to neutral walls. Rag rolling and stippling were also common painting techniques during that era and can enhance this look.
